#include <bits/stdc++.h>
// #include <ext/pb_ds/assoc_container.hpp>
using namespace std;
// using namespace __gnu_pbds;

#define SPEED                     \
    ios_base::sync_with_stdio(0); \
    cin.tie(NULL);                \
    cout.tie(NULL);

#define pb push_back
#define ins insert
#define fi first
#define se second

#define endl "\n"
#define ALL(x) x.begin(), x.end()
#define sz(x) x.size()
#define intt long long

const intt mod = 1e9 + 7;
const intt base = 31;
const intt inf = 1e9;
const intt mxN = 500000 + 5;
const intt L = 21;

vector<vector<intt>> graph;
set<intt> st[mxN];
vector<intt> roots(mxN), color(mxN), xalq(mxN);

vector<intt> comp;
void dfs(intt node) {
    color[node] = 1;
    comp.pb(node);
    for(auto u : graph[node]) {
        if(!color[u]) {
            dfs(u);
        }
    }
}

void solve() {
    intt n, m;
    cin >> n >> m;
    graph.assign(n + 1, vector<intt>{});
    vector<pair<intt,intt>> buses;
    for(intt i = 0; i < m; i++) {
        char c;
        intt a, b;
        cin >> a >> b >> c;
        if(c == 'T') {
            graph[a].pb(b);
            graph[b].pb(a);
        } else {
            buses.pb({a, b});
        }
    }

    vector<intt> r;
    intt cnt = 0;
    for(intt i = 1; i <= n; i++) {
        if(!color[i]) {
            dfs(i);
            intt represent = *min_element(ALL(comp));
            for(auto u : comp) roots[u] = represent;
            r.pb(represent);
            xalq[represent] = comp.size();
            cnt++;
            comp.clear();
        }
    }
    // cout << cnt << endl;

    for(intt i = 0; i < buses.size(); i++) {
        intt a = roots[buses[i].fi], b = roots[buses[i].se];
        if(a != b) {
            st[a].insert(b);
            st[b].insert(a);
        }
    }

    intt ans = 0;
    for(auto root : r) {
        if(st[root].size() >= cnt-1) {
            ans += xalq[root];  
        }
    }
    cout << ans << endl;
}

signed main() {
    SPEED;
    intt tst = 1;
    // cin >> tst;
    while (tst--) {
        solve();
    }
}
